문제 설명
자연수 n을 뒤집어 각 자리 숫자를 원소로 가지는 배열 형태로 리턴해주세요. 예를들어 n이 12345이면 [5,4,3,2,1]을 리턴합니다.
제한사항
- n은 10,000,000,000이하인 자연수입니다.
입출력 예시
n | return |
---|---|
12345 | [5,4,3,2,1] |
나의 풀이
리스트의 역순을 구할 때는 인덱스 슬라이싱을 이용하면 좀 더 pythonic한 코드를 작성할 수 있다.
def solution(n):
return list(map(int, str(n)))[::-1]
'Programmers' 카테고리의 다른 글
[Programmers] 귤 고르기 - level 2 (0) | 2023.01.31 |
---|---|
[Programmers] 숫자 변환하기 - level 2 (0) | 2023.01.29 |
[Programmers] 자릿수 더하기 - level 1 (0) | 2022.10.01 |
[Programmers] 약수의 합 - level 1 (0) | 2022.09.28 |
[Programmers] 서울에서 김서방 찾기 - level 1 (0) | 2022.09.26 |